Market Pulse: Opportunity 📈
The Parkersburg, IA real estate market is currently a Buyer's Market. Homes are retaining 97% of their value (Sale Price to List Price Ratio). With 13 active listings and 5 closed sales this month, inventory remains at 7.1 months of supply. Trends over the last half-year show median values moving down by 13%, while Average Days on Market has increased by 7%. Transaction speed in Parkersburg is currently 5 days slower than the broader Butler benchmark.

Market Insights & FAQ
How is the real estate market in Parkersburg, IA performing right now?
The data indicates a stable environment in Parkersburg, IA. Inventory is at 7.1 months, meaning a balanced environment with steady turnover. Inventory levels provide a healthy range of options for prospective buyers.
What are the current pricing trends for Parkersburg, IA real estate?
Currently, $214,000 represents the median entry point in Parkersburg, IA. Over the past half-year, home values in Parkersburg have moved downward by approximately 13% based on regional transaction data.
Are sellers in Parkersburg, IA getting their full asking price?
Buyers have room for negotiation in Parkersburg, IA, with a Sale Price to List Price Ratio of 97.3%. On average, properties in Parkersburg are transitioning from active to sold status in 69 days.
